Elisabeth Wende is a scholar working on Immunology, Molecular Biology and Oncology. According to data from OpenAlex, Elisabeth Wende has authored 10 papers receiving a total of 525 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Immunology, 3 papers in Molecular Biology and 3 papers in Oncology. Recurrent topics in Elisabeth Wende's work include Complement system in diseases (6 papers), Drug Transport and Resistance Mechanisms (2 papers) and Antibiotic Resistance in Bacteria (2 papers). Elisabeth Wende is often cited by papers focused on Complement system in diseases (6 papers), Drug Transport and Resistance Mechanisms (2 papers) and Antibiotic Resistance in Bacteria (2 papers). Elisabeth Wende collaborates with scholars based in Germany, United Kingdom and Hungary. Elisabeth Wende's co-authors include Andreas Klos, Peter N. Monk, Kathryn Wareham, Daniel Knappe, Eszter Ostorházi, Rico Schmidt, Ralf Hoffmann, Svenja Meierjohann, Manfred Schartl and André Bleich and has published in prestigious journals such as PLoS ONE, Cancer Research and Pharmacological Reviews.
